Output 22b61e38846a2894dc87ad7698498da28c1908d0f5e64eb697dd31ee16eb0c2d:0

value
1078014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f15f440b7b8cb2ea27e947da1519ac33db2d8a32 OP_EQUAL
address
3PhGtxZQYNkxxoRJNmF83TtHkzg8MJNhbh
transaction
22b61e38846a2894dc87ad7698498da28c1908d0f5e64eb697dd31ee16eb0c2d
confirmations
143789
spent
true